New York Minute
By Eliza Willard


     This book is the official novelization, based on the Big-Screen movie with Mary Kate and Ashley Olsen. There is nonstop action as Jane Ryan goes to give her competition speech for the McGill Fellowship to Oxford University. At the same time her twin sister, Roxy, skips school and heads into New York with a stack of CD's to a Simple Plan video shoot with the hopes of getting a record deal for her band.

    Truant Officer, Max Lomax is hot on Roxy's heels, and the fun really begins when Roxy tries to help Jane get to her competition in time with everything going wrong. The hilarious situations the girls get into and the way they solve the problems they encounter will keep you reading and laughing. They get involved with Music Pirates, a Senator and her son, a dog named Reinaldo, and a man that they keep spilling coffee on. Great characters, a breakneck plot, and laughs galore. A must have for Ashley and Mary-Kate fans.
